Gingival Lift
A gingival lift—also known as gum lift or gum contouring—is a cosmetic dental procedure that reshapes and reduces excess gum tissue. It is ideal for patients who are self-conscious about a "gummy" smile, helping create a more balanced and symmetrical appearance.
Laser technology is the preferred method for performing gingival lifts, as it allows for precise and safe reshaping of the gums with minimal discomfort. The laser targets only the excess tissue, preserving surrounding healthy gums. Patients typically need only topical anesthesia, experience little to no bleeding, and benefit from faster healing compared to traditional surgical approaches.
Gum Grafting
Gum grafting is designed to restore receding gums, protect exposed tooth roots, and improve the overall appearance of the smile. Gum recession, often the result of periodontal disease, is both a cosmetic and a functional problem since gums are essential for protecting teeth and maintaining a healthy smile.
During this procedure, a small amount of tissue—generally harvested from the roof of the patient's mouth—is grafted onto the receded area to cover exposed roots. In certain cases, donor tissue may be used instead. The graft is carefully positioned and sutured to the natural gum, protecting the teeth and restoring the gumline. Gum grafting not only addresses cosmetic concerns, such as elongated teeth, but also reduces the risk of further recession and bone loss.
Gum grafts can be performed on one or several teeth to even out the gumline, restore natural contours following tooth loss, and prevent gum and bone collapse. These procedures can also help alleviate sensitivity in exposed roots, particularly to hot or cold foods.
